  • The Math Intervention Specialist provides guidance in Mathematics to identified at-risk students in learning the subject matter and skills that are necessary to their academic success. The interventionist is a highly qualified teacher of literacy/mathematics who works primarily with students who require strategic and intensive intervention in small-group or individual setting. The focus of the interventionist is to develop a student-centered system of intervention that effectively works to close the achievement gap in math. The goal of the intervention specialist is to ensure that students are able to master grade level skills, standards and curriculum by instructing students who have not met Math proficiency.

    The Interventionist Will:
    • Work with the Intervention Coordinator and Instructional Coaches to design and implement the school's MTSS/RTI structure.
    • Demonstrate exemplary classroom math/literacy instructional practice and possess a deep understanding of mathematics theory for the purpose of effective best practices to improve student achievement results and close achievement gaps.
    • Work with students who are not yet demonstrating grade-level proficiency in math/literacy.
    • Deliver instruction in individual or small-group settings to students assigned by Intervention Coordinator.
    • Develop instructional materials and coordinate the delivery of instruction.
    • Regularly analyze data from interim assessments and other progress monitoring tools to assess student progress while delivering focused intervention to students.
    • Motivate struggling learners and work to change negative self-perceptions that some students have about their ability to be good at math/literacy.
    • Listen, support and model effective communication and problem-solving skills.
    • Build self-awareness and self-confidence with students.
    • Participates and contributes as a member of the Intervention Team.
    • Attend trainings as assigned and participate in all monthly staff meetings.
